@alakamve2022

Почему append() заменяет последний элемент в списке?

with open("test.json", "r") as f:
    ref=json.load(f)  
listtak:list=ref["pepememe"]
listtak.append(input())
ref["pepememe"]=listtak.lower()
with open("test.json", 'w') as f:
    json.dump(ref, f, indent=4)
print(a)

Почему этот код работает НЕправильно?
Пожалуйста помогите
  • Вопрос задан
  • 88 просмотров
Решения вопроса 2
@Zzzz9
Не видно как он работает и как должен, и почему не правильно.
Ответ написан
Комментировать
Lord_of_Rings
@Lord_of_Rings
Python developer
Начните с того, что вот это with open("test.json"), "r") as f: вообще НЕ работает.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ы